Prunus depressa (Sand Cherry)
Prunus depressa, commonly known as Sand Cherry, is a low growing shrub that is often used for erosion control due to its spreading, mat-forming habit. It has small, oval-shaped leaves and produces clusters of fragrant white flowers in the spring, followed by small, edible berries. This plant is typically found in sandy or rocky areas, hence its common name. Sand Cherry is a hardy plant and can tolerate a range of soil conditions.
